抱歉,我是语言模型,无法编写代码。但是,您可以使用Python编写一个程序,利用第三方库来实现自动翻译Excel单元格中的英文,例如使用Google Translate API或者百度翻译API。以下是一个使用Google Translate API的示例代码:

import openpyxl
from googletrans import Translator

# 打开Excel文件
workbook = openpyxl.load_workbook('example.xlsx')
sheet = workbook.active

# 创建翻译器对象
translator = Translator()

# 遍历所有单元格
for row in sheet.iter_rows():
    for cell in row:
        if cell.value is not None and isinstance(cell.value, str):
            # 如果单元格内容为英文,则进行翻译
            if cell.value.isascii():
                translation = translator.translate(cell.value, src='en', dest='zh-CN')
                cell.value = translation.text

# 保存修改后的Excel文件
workbook.save('example_translated.xlsx')

这个程序使用了openpyxl和googletrans库,前者用于读取和修改Excel文件,后者用于进行翻译。程序会遍历Excel文件中的所有单元格,如果单元格内容为英文,则使用Google Translate API进行翻译,并将翻译结果写入单元格中。最后,程序将修改后的Excel文件保存到新文件中。

写一个代码将Excel中单元格内的英文自动翻译成中文

原文地址: https://www.cveoy.top/t/topic/XHq 著作权归作者所有。请勿转载和采集!

免费AI点我,无需注册和登录